About

Iain McNamara is a scholar working on Surgery, Biomedical Engineering and Epidemiology. According to data from OpenAlex, Iain McNamara has authored 56 papers receiving a total of 982 indexed citations (citations by other indexed papers that have themselves been cited), including 37 papers in Surgery, 11 papers in Biomedical Engineering and 8 papers in Epidemiology. Recurrent topics in Iain McNamara's work include Total Knee Arthroplasty Outcomes (22 papers), Orthopaedic implants and arthroplasty (16 papers) and Lower Extremity Biomechanics and Pathologies (9 papers). Iain McNamara is often cited by papers focused on Total Knee Arthroplasty Outcomes (22 papers), Orthopaedic implants and arthroplasty (16 papers) and Lower Extremity Biomechanics and Pathologies (9 papers). Iain McNamara collaborates with scholars based in United Kingdom, United States and Australia. Iain McNamara's co-authors include Toby O. Smith, Simon Donell, D O Ho‐Yen, Martyn J. Parker, Karen Postle, J. Robert Giffin, Trevor B. Birmingham, Peter J. Fowler, P. Hopgood and Constantinos Loizou and has published in prestigious journals such as Cochrane Database of Systematic Reviews, BMJ and The American Journal of Sports Medicine.
